You did not mention what tire size you want to run. The RE 4.5" works with 32x11.50's without trimming. The RE 5.5" is good with 33" with minor trimming.

my XJ on 4.5+ lonagarm lift is daily driven and is my only vehicle and my son will ride in it as well.. longarms with decent spings&shocks will ride 10x's better than short arms.
 
my lift is comprised of various parts( Older RE springsm clayton hd TB setup,terafrex shackles and roughcountry longarms w/bilstein 5150's and it rides great plus I dont have that much invested...
 
If I were you I would just add a 1"-2" coil spacer, some longer shocks and a long arm kit. If you need more lift in the rear just add a longer shackle or a shackle relocation. Or trim more and keep what you have lift and add the long arm.
